We’ve had several requests over the last couple of years asking about the possibility of training to be an Iyengar yoga teacher at Yogawest.
We have been working away behind the scenes to arrange this, and now have some exciting news…
As many of you know, we have been in discussion with a senior teacher in recent months about setting up an Iyengar teacher training course at Yogawest.
There have been various hoops to jump through, but we are delighted to announce that we now have IY(UK) approval to proceed with the course.
And the really fantastic news is that Sheila Haswell has agreed to teach the first course. Sheila is a well known figure in the Iyengar world, running and teaching at Sarva in High Wycombe until recently. She is a wonderful teacher: compassionate, wise and a brilliant trainer. Although she will still be based up the M4, she has agreed to come to Yogawest regularly to run this course for us.
The course will start in 2015 (probably summer time, with some additional pre-course preparation dates in the New Year tbc) and run for approx 2 years towards the Introductory level exam in Summer/Autumn 2017.
Our next step is to confirm dates and costs and we will update this page when this is arranged.

Please note: to train to be an Iyengar teacher you need to have 3 years of Iyengar classes under your belt, and your IY(UK) teacher will need to endorse you for training.
